Advanced AI Fraud Testing Unveiled

Neovera, a trusted provider of cybersecurity and cloud services, has launched its Fraud Red Team, the industry’s most advanced AI-driven fraud testing solution, announced on August 27, 2025. Designed for financial and highly regulated institutions, this offering uses cutting-edge AI tools to simulate sophisticated fraud scenarios, enabling banks to identify and address vulnerabilities before exploitation. The solution addresses the growing challenge of automated, AI-driven attacks that traditional testing methods can no longer counter.

Comprehensive Fraud Simulation

Neovera’s Fraud Red Team employs a robust portfolio of AI-driven tools, including hundreds of synthetic voice profiles, forged IDs, and automated agents mimicking human behavior. These tools test defenses across six critical fraud domains: face (deepfake selfies), voice (AI voice clones), documents (forged IDs), checks (counterfeit designs), behavior (mimicking trusted patterns), and deception (AI-driven scams). By replicating real-world fraud tactics, the solution ensures institutions can strengthen their defenses against evolving threats.

Real-World Testing in Live Environments

Unlike conventional approaches, Neovera’s testing operates in live production environments, providing a realistic assessment of controls under conditions exploited by criminals. “Fraud is no longer a game of chance. With AI, it’s a system of scale,” said Jerry Tylman, Senior Vice President of Fraud Red Team at Neovera. “Our program gives banks a way to fight back with the same level of sophistication. We’re not just testing controls and technology, we’re stress-testing the future.” This approach validates security measures in real-time, high-stakes settings.

Strategic Partnerships and Impact

Neovera collaborates with over 20 of the world’s top 100 financial institutions, including major banks in the U.S., U.K., Canada, and Mexico, as well as regional banks and credit unions. The Fraud Red Team’s ability to simulate advanced threats like ID spoofing, voice liveness bypass, and bot-automated transactions positions it as a critical tool for highly regulated sectors aiming to stay ahead of AI-enabled fraud.
